Transaction e4aeac031050b9623e9c0a5b548fc6f53c88107c5820fcdfd24fb6276417145f
1 Input
1 Output
-
e4aeac031050b9623e9c0a5b548fc6f53c88107c5820fcdfd24fb6276417145f:0
- value
- 959659
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ef2acf27d8db909a4c6b21411fe38a16d6df1bad
- address
- bc1qau4v7f7cmwgf5nrty9q3lcu2zmtd7xadlcf48p